#180be4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#180be4 is composed of 9.4% red, 4.3% green and 89.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.5% cyan, 95.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 243.6 degrees, a saturation of 90.8% and a lightness of 46.9%. #180be4 color hex could be obtained by blending #3016ff with #0000c9. Closest websafe color is: #0000cc.

Shades and Tints of #180be4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000003 is the darkest color, while #f1f0fe is the lightest one.
